Hungary limits state support for Ukrainian refugees to those from conflict-affected regions.

Hungary has enacted a new law limiting state support for Ukrainian refugees, potentially affecting thousands of them. The law only offers aid to refugees from regions directly impacted by the ongoing conflict in Ukraine. The Hungarian government plans to update the list of affected regions monthly. Currently, around 31,000 Ukrainian refugees are in Hungary, and it is unclear how many will be impacted by this regulation. Human rights groups warn that vulnerable refugees, particularly the Roma ethnic minority from the Transcarpathian region, are at risk of being displaced.
